Wednesday, June 4, 2008
Camp 1 7,800ft
They're off... The June 1 Mountain Trip expedition flew in late on Monday afternoon to basecamp, and got started climbing yesterday. They moved to camp 1 about 5 miles up the Kahiltna glacier from the landing strip. Today they carried a load of food, fuel, and extra supplies to about 10,000 feet where they dug a hole in the snow and cached it to pick up later. They will move up to the next camp at 11,000 ft tomorrow, then return to pick the cache up the following day. This is going to be the general strategy to work their way up the mountain. They break their loads up into two different carries, and it allows them time to acclimate to the progressively higher altitudes.
